What is ZKHF-010 used for?

28 June 2024
ZKHF-010 is a groundbreaking addition to the world of pharmacological research, emerging from the collaborative efforts of some of the most prestigious research institutions globally. A highly specialized drug, ZKHF-010 is primarily developed to target specific cellular processes within the human body, particularly focusing on the immune response and inflammation pathways. As an innovative therapeutic agent, it promises to offer new avenues for treating chronic inflammatory diseases and autoimmune disorders. The extensive research and development phases of ZKHF-010 have seen significant contributions from leading pharmacological and biomedical researchers, making it one of the most promising drugs currently in clinical trials.

ZKHF-010 is classified as a small-molecule inhibitor designed to interfere with key signaling pathways that regulate immune function and inflammation. The drug has shown considerable efficacy in preclinical models and is presently undergoing Phase III clinical trials, reflecting its advanced stage of development. The trials aim to establish its safety profile and therapeutic potential further, with initial data indicating promising results in terms of both efficacy and tolerability.

The mechanism of action of ZKHF-010 involves the precise inhibition of a specific enzyme within the immune signaling cascade. This enzyme plays a critical role in the activation and proliferation of immune cells, particularly T-cells, which are central to the body's inflammatory response. By selectively targeting and inhibiting this enzyme, ZKHF-010 effectively reduces the activation of T-cells, thereby mitigating the inflammatory response that is often at the heart of many chronic inflammatory and autoimmune conditions.

The drug works through allosteric modulation, where it binds to a site distinct from the active site of the enzyme, inducing a conformational change that reduces its activity. This selective inhibition ensures that the drug's effects are both potent and specific, minimizing the risk of off-target effects that could lead to unwanted side effects. Moreover, the allosteric nature of its inhibition allows for a more nuanced regulation of enzyme activity, offering a fine-tuned approach to managing inflammation.

One of the key indications for ZKHF-010 is in the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is, a chronic autoimmune condition characterized by persistent inflammation and joint damage. Current treatment options for rheumatoid arthritis often come with significant side effects and limited efficacy, especially in long-term use. ZKHF-010 offers a novel approach by targeting the underlying immune mechanisms responsible for the disease, potentially providing a more effective and safer treatment alternative.

Beyond rheumatoid arthritis, ZKHF-010 is also being investigated for its potential applications in other autoimmune diseases such as lupus and multiple sclerosis, as well as chronic inflammatory conditions like inflammatory bowel disease (IBD). The broad applicability of ZKHF-010 across these diverse conditions underscores its versatility and promise as a therapeutic agent.

In the context of rheumatoid arthritis, the clinical trials have shown that patients treated with ZKHF-010 experience significant reductions in joint pain and swelling compared to those receiving standard treatments or placebo. These improvements are not only statistically significant but also translate to meaningful enhancements in patients' quality of life, enabling them to engage in daily activities with reduced discomfort.
